We booked a late deal which for the length of cruise was a great price. Slightly worried re an inside cabin however it proved better than port hole/window of the past due to clever use of mirrors creating space. Deck 9 aft amazingly quiet. The turn down service was a luxury with towel animals. Our towels were always thick. We didnt bother with a premium drinks package as our usual drinks were well ...
